After a one-year hiatus due to the pandemic, GrassRoots Garden is once again hosting the annual Carrot Harvest Day on Saturday, December 11th

This event is always a wonderful close to the garden year, and a time when the friends and families of GrassRoots gather together to enjoy some friendly competition, good food, and connection.

The event starts at 10:30 for mingling and selecting the best carrot pulling spot.  At 11am sharp, everyone starts harvesting carrots, and searching for the biggest, longest and most unique.  As the judges judge the entries, we’ll enjoy delicious carrot-ginger soup, carrot cake, hot chocolate and warm crusty bread as we review what we’ve accomplished in the year.

All winners receive sweet and homey carrot related prizes!  It’s fun for the whole family. Please remember to wear masks as part of FOOD for Lane County’s COVID protocols.  We look forward to seeing you!
